New SMS Template Configuration & Approval Process

Purpose

The purpose of this documentation is to clearly explain how a new SMS template request is raised by the POD team, how the Solution Enablers (SE) team processes and approves the template, and how the approved template is implemented across Rentlz systems for successful message delivery.


Step-by-Step Process :

  1. Identify the requirement for a new SMS template (example: New booking flow, OTP change, cancellation update, etc.)

  2. Raise an SE ticket with the following mandatory information: Sample SE for reference -  https://moveinsync.atlassian.net/browse/SE-51016 

    • Template purpose

    • Full SMS content

    • Suggested template name

    • Assign the ticket to the (SE) Team.

  3. SE team will take over the process from here , It usually takes within 24–48 hours.
    If approved → SE receives a Template ID. If rejected → SE updates POD and POD fixes the issue, and resubmits to SE 

Once the SE team completes the approval process then Rentlz will again Raise a separate SE for configuring the SMS on Consul.

On the new SE Ticket you need to update the approved template , and ask SE to update the same in the Consul Configuration of the required server. 
The new template should be added in the Communicationsmsconfig folder and then based on the template number it should be also added in the details. And then the detail number of that template should be added in the flow of where that template needed ( rider message, driver message etc ).
